Job description

Proton Technologies, Inc., an affiliate of Reynolds and Reynolds, is seeking a highly skilled Systems Engineer with strong server, hybrid cloud, and networking experience. This role will support both escalated service requests (Level 2-3) and assist our Cloud Migration and Projects teams with Azure environment work, hybrid domain configurations, and infrastructure deployments.

This position is ideal for an engineer who can confidently navigate Azure AD / Entra ID, Windows Server, Active Directory, networking, and cloud migration workflows-and who thrives in a fast-paced MSP environment.

Primary responsibilities:

  • Prioritize, work, and resolve Level 2-3 tickets in the Engineering Ticket Queue
  • Serve as an escalation point for complex server, cloud, and network-related issues
  • Support cloud migration efforts, including Azure AD/Entra ID configurations, hybrid domain join environments, and server-to-cloud transitions
  • Troubleshoot and maintain Windows Server environments,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S, and related services
  • Configure, deploy, and troubleshoot firewalls, switches, access points, VPNs, VLANs, and routing
  • Evaluate customer systems and networks to identify performance bottlenecks and lead remediation efforts
  • Participate in the planning and deployment of new infrastructure, including servers, cloud resources, and network hardware
  • Ensure high availability and reliability of client network and system resources

Requirements

Do you have experience in Windows?, * Must have 5 years of industry experience with at least 2 years in a MSP environment

  • Seasoned in Exchange Management / Server Management / Service Migrations / Virtual Machines
  • Server Knowledge and Experience - Active Directory / Replication / DNS / Group Policy / IIS Services
  • Network Experience - Firewall Management / Routing / Security Policies / NAT Translation / Port Forwarding / VPN Management / VLANs / VPN / DNS / DHCP / Diagnostics and Logging
  • Cisco Networking Experience - Cisco Routing Protocols / Command Line Interface
  • Experience Managing / Setup of Microsoft 365 and GSuite
  • Familiarity with Microsoft Servers lineup of products Windows Server and Microsoft Exchange Server
  • Comfortable with VoIP Applications and Management and AWS deployments
  • Ability to solve complex problems in a faced paced environment and diligently follow through to resolution
